[SOLVED] Reinstalled XP: Wireless Gone

My laptop (2006 Thinkpad) was recently infected with some very nasty viruses. I was advised to completely reinstall XP to resolve the problem. After the reinstallation, I loaded back Microsoft Office, Photoshop, etc. However, I can't get my internet connection to work.

My laptop was part of a network with three other computers. All four computers use wireless internet and are in close proximity to each other. After I reinstalled XP, I'm not able to see 'Wireless Network Connection' in my Network Connections. The only thing there is '1394 Connection'.

My Thinkpad has an inbuilt wireless network adapter that has worked consistently for the last two years. I have no idea why I'm not able to connect to my network. Please help!

Have you checked the CD's you got with the laptop? Usually they give you a resource CD or motherboard CD which includes all the drivers you need to install. When you re-install Windows, you do delete all the drivers.
